On Sat 2009-09-05 14:09:21, Mark Brown wrote:
> The WM831x devices feature two software controlled status LEDs with
> hardware assisted blinking.
>
> The device can also autonomously control the LEDs based on a selection
> of sources. This can be configured at boot time using either platform
> data or the chip OTP. A sysfs file in the style of that for triggers
> allowing the control source to be configured at run time. Triggers
> can't be used here since they can't depend on the implementation details
> of a specific LED type.
I believe people *were* doing that with triggers in other drivers...?
